CVE-2016-9757
CVE-2016-9757 affects Rapid7 Nexpose 6.4.12 UI, where an authenticated user with tag-creation rights can inject cross-site scripting into the tag name field. CVE-2012-6493
Cross-site request forgery CSRF vulnerability in Rapid7 Nexpose Security Console before 5.5.4 allows remote attackers to hijack the authentication of unspecified victims for requests that delete scan data and sites via a request to data/site/delete...
